Na próxima quinta-feira, dia 11 de outubro, às 17h, na sala 1201, o Curso de Relações Internacionais da Universidade Federal do Rio Grande (FURG) promoverá uma palestra, em formato de videoconferência, com o prof. Dr. Fabrício Henricco Chagas Bastos, intitulada "Briefing note como ferramenta pedagógica para o ensino de relações internacionais". As inscrições são gratuitas e ocorrerão no local. Serão emitidos certificados de ouvinte através do Projeto III Ciclo de Palestras de Relações Internacionais.

Sobre o convidado:

Fabrício Henricco Chagas Bastos: Postdoctoral Research Fellow at the University of Melbournes School of Psychological Sciences. Former Lecturer at the Universidad de los Andes (Colombia), Australian National University (Australia) and at the Grande Dourados Federal University (Brazil). Emerging Leaders in the Americas Program (Canada) and Endeavour Fellowships (Australia) Alumnus. PhD in Latin American Studies (University of Sao Paulo and Carleton University). Postdoctoral research at the University of Cambridge and the Australian National University. Specialised in the intersection of International Relations and Social Psychology, his research takes an interdisciplinary approach with the broad aim to study the political, economic and developmental challenges faced by the Global South. More specifically, he investigates the psychology that arises from resource scarcity. In one line of work, he studies how behavioural science can help shape interventions to reduce poverty and inequality. In another line of work, his research focuses on intergroup relations, with specific emphasis on the association between stereotyping and behaviour.
